Output 9683251851a305f87f091c12df3a235304f4ee81ea593723d4e9733c308478f8:0

value
21039890
script pubkey
OP_0 OP_PUSHBYTES_20 efa9d9edea301b8fb4b227d2428a8c7329775463
address
ltc1qa75anm02xqdcld9jylfy9z5vwv5hw4rrr9fyfy
transaction
9683251851a305f87f091c12df3a235304f4ee81ea593723d4e9733c308478f8
spent
true